This buzzing station is more than just a gateway to your next destination. It's equipped with all the facilities you need for a comfortable and convenient journey. Nottingham Station hosts a well-staffed ticket office open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 7:15 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ays. Travelers can also utilize ticket machines for a quicker, self-service option, including accessible machines for those who need them. The station supports smartcards and offers easy ticket collection services for online purchases.
For those who require assistance, Nottingham Station ensures easy and inclusive access with features like step-free access throughout, available lifts to all platforms, and numerous ramps. Help points and an information desk are ready to assist, making it easier for everyone to travel with confidence. The presence of CCTVs adds an extra layer of security to your trip.
When it comes to creature comforts, you'll find heated waiting rooms, accessible restrooms, including a baby changing facility, and a variety of cafes and vending machines for a quick snack or refreshment. There’s also a chance to indulge in a bit of retail therapy at the on-site shops. Unfortunately, Wi-Fi is not yet available, so be sure to download all your important details before you arrive.
Getting to and from Nottingham Station is made simple with a range of transport options. Rail replacement buses conveniently operate from Carrington Street directly in front of the station, ensuring you're never stranded if regular services are suspended. For those looking to explore the city, local bus services connect the station to various parts of Nottingham, managed by a comprehensive network.
Nottingham is also part of the vibrant tram network known as the Nottingham Express Transit. Not to mention, there's through-ticketing available for seamless travel to East Midlands Airport, courtesy of the regular Skylink service operated by Nottingham City Transport. This makes your journey from the train station to the skies as smooth as possible.

Nestled in the small yet charming town of Rishton in Lancashire, Rishton Train Station serves as a quaint gateway to the surrounding beauty of the North West of England. This unstaffed train station may not boast lavish amenities, but it offers essential services to ensure your journey is smooth and hassle-free.
Rishton Station, while unstaffed, provides some helpful facilities for travelers. Ticket machines are available to retrieve tickets bought online, making it convenient for those who prefer digital transactions. While there are no staff members to assist on-site, travelers can make use of an induction loop for enhanced communication. For those needing help on-site, calling the helpline at 08002006060 is recommended. However, if physical assistance is required, you can request passenger assistance through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ring an inclusive travel experience for everyone. It's vital to note that the station lacks some amenities, such as toilets, waiting rooms, or refreshment facilities. While these might be limitations, it keeps Rishton Station straightforward, focusing on core travel services.
The station offers partial step-free access. While the Colne platform is accessible via a 15-meter ramp, the Preston platform requires navigating a footbridge with stairs. Although it's a Category B station, efforts have been made to provide ramps for train access, allowing passengers to board with ease. Rishton is well-connected in terms of transportation options. If you're looking to travel by bus, the new pickup point is conveniently located near bus stops at the junction of Blackburn Road and Station Road. This serves buses towards Blackburn and Accrington, offering further connectivity for passengers heading to local areas. For those relying on taxi services, options can be explored at the Cab4You service for seamless travel planning. For any inquiries regarding bus schedules, Busline can be contacted at 0871 200 2233.
